Output 9708569c429f77e990545c1aba3f492ccdcd30260b07f8a23910de26895ae366:0

value
56274
script pubkey
OP_0 OP_PUSHBYTES_20 e3abf057d7cfba334a0c2c39d07baad4f24e62da
address
bc1quw4lq47he7arxjsv9suaq7a26neyuck6k884nm
transaction
9708569c429f77e990545c1aba3f492ccdcd30260b07f8a23910de26895ae366
spent
true